Spoilt Ice manufacturers


Yes, your refrigerator is an electric appliance. Your plumber won't repair your refrigerator or freezer, yet if it has an ice maker attached, you need to call your plumber to deal with that component.
Your ice maker has its water line, and also this link can get dripping or clogged. When you change your fridge, you must reconnect your ice manufacturer, or else it may create a fault.
Your plumber can examine your ice manufacturer and also tell you if it is redeemable. You can alter your icemaker without transforming your refrigerator if it's not.

Faulty washing devices


It's a little bit extra difficult with a washing device. Your cleaning equipment is most likely to have a plumbing-related fault than an electric one. Of all, numerous washing maker mistakes can be tied to water pressure. If the water your machine gets is too quickly, it might ruin even the electric elements. In this case, changing the element will not quit the damages, just cost you even more cash.
A plumber can also spot damage on the equipment's plumbing components. We can find a dripping or ruptured pipe as well as even strained plumbing work.

You are stuck at home and isolating yourself. But what do you do if your refrigerator breaks down, or your car won't start, or there's a big plumbing problem at home? Even though such services are available, relying on repairmen seems like it should be the last resort.


Let's say your refrigerator or washing machine isn't working. But "not working" is such a generic term that a Google search doesn't help you get any closer to solving the problem.



Repair Clinic is an excellent place for the layperson to figure out what the actual issue is, and how to fix it.



Start at "Repair Help" and key in the malfunctioning appliance's model number or choose from a list of products. You will see a list of several common problems with that type of product, in plain English, so you can figure out what is and isn't your problem. This is where Repair Clinic is better than a random Google search.



Once you've found your problem, go through the recommended solutions one by one. Repair Clinic lists them by severity, so make sure you have ruled out the first cause before moving on the next one.



The website claims it has over 4,500 videos by technicians, over 7,000 diagrams and manuals, and over 700 articles to solve common problems.



Apart from suggesting fixes, Repair Clinic also sells parts and shows you how to remove, replace, or install items. If they still ship to you, you might save money with a DIY repair job.
